Traditional grid planning has long focused on centralized generation, transmission, and distribution systems designed for one-way power flow. However, the rise of Distributed Energy Resources (DERs) has highlighted significant flaws in this model. IGP solutions emphasize bidirectional power flows, real-time grid interactivity, and probabilistic load forecasting. IGP requires utilities to evaluate generation, transmission, distribution, and demand-side resources as interconnected components. By integrating these elements, utilities can defer traditional infrastructure upgrades and achieve cost savings through innovative non-wires alternatives like demand response.

Work bundling in integrated grid planning refers to the strategic grouping of related tasks or projects to optimize resources, reduce costs, and minimize disruptions. For example, utilities can bundle maintenance tasks with system upgrades or combine vegetation management with grid hardening measures. This approach minimizes the need for multiple site visits, reduces overall costs, and enhances grid reliability and resilience.
